    The painting Nightnoon by Jimmy Ernst is a thought-provoking artwork that showcases the artist's unique style and technique. Created in 1965, this oil on canvas piece measures 132 x 168 cm and is currently housed at the Smithsonian American Art Museum.     A Life Forged in the Crucible of Exile

    The story of Jimmy Ernst is one inextricably woven into the turbulent fabric of twentieth-century history, a narrative defined by displacement, survival, and the profound influence of the avant-garde. Born Hans-Ulrich Ernst in 1920 in Cologne, Germany, his very existence was shaped by the shadows of the era's most seismic political shifts. As the son of the legendary Surrealist master Max Ernst and the esteemed art historian Luise Straus-Ernst, Jimmy was born into a world where art and intellect were under constant siege. The rise of the Nazi regime in Germany brought personal tragedy to his doorstep; following the search of his mother's apartment by the SS, the family was fractured, eventually leading to his migration to New York in 1938. This transition from the heart of Europe to the burgeoning energy of America would become the defining metamorphosis of his life, turning a child of the German intelligentsia into a vital voice within the American art scene.

    His early years were marked by an extraordinary exposure to the giants of Surrealism. During childhood visits to France, he moved through circles that included Salvador Dalí, Joan Miró, and Man Ray, absorbing the dreamlike logic and subversive spirit of the movement long before he ever picked up a brush with intent. However, his journey was also shadowed by the unimaginable loss of his mother in the Holocaust, a trauma that added a layer of poignant gravity to his later explorations of identity and memory.

    The Irascible Spirit and the New York School

    Upon arriving in New York, Ernst did not merely observe the art world; he became one of its most active architects. His connection to Peggy Guggenheim—who would become his stepmother—placed him at the epicenter of modernism. Serving as the director of the influential Art of This Century gallery, he helped curate the very movements that would redefine Western painting. It was during this era that Ernst emerged as a prominent member of the Irascible Eighteen, a defiant group of painters who famously protested the conservative policies of the Metropolitan Museum of Art. This group, captured in a legendary photograph by Nina Leen, included titans such as Jackson Pollock, Willem de Kooning, and Mark Rothko.

    As a painter, Ernst’s work evolved from the inherited echoes of Surrealism into the vigorous, gestural language of Abstract Expressionism. His canvases became arenas for exploring the tension between form and chaos, often reflecting the themes of exile and the fractured nature of memory that haunted his biography. His technique was characterized by a profound sensitivity to texture and movement, allowing him to communicate the visceral emotions of a life lived amidst global upheaval. Through his brush, the trauma of the past and the liberation of the New York School found a singular, expressive voice.

    Legacy and Artistic Endurance

    The later years of Ernst's life were marked by both academic distinction and continued creative vigor. His contributions to art education were solidified through his role as an instructor at Brooklyn College, where he helped shape the next generation of American designers and painters. His accolades were numerous, reflecting a career of immense merit:

    Guggenheim Fellowship (1961), recognizing his mastery of abstract form.

    Election to the National Academy of Design as an Associate Academician in 1977.

    An honorary degree from Long Island University in 1982.

    Membership in the prestigious American Academy of Arts and Letters.

    Even as he moved to the tranquil landscapes of East Hampton and Florida, the echoes of his complex heritage remained present in his work. His memoir, A Not-So-Still Life, serves as a moving testament to a man who navigated the wreckage of the old world to help build the foundations of the new. Today, Jimmy Ernst is remembered not just as the heir to a Surrealist dynasty, but as a formidable artist in his own right—a painter whose work stands as a bridge between the fractured dreams of Europe and the explosive freedom of American abstraction.
